with a slam and flick
Seamus Heaney used "with a slam and flick" not "with a slam and a flick" in his poem, which seems to indicates that a slam plus a flick composes a unique action of a blacksmith when he works on metal.
我的翻译是: 长打短敲; 重打轻敲; 一抡一颠
